- The distance between Cork, Ireland and Bushehr, Iran is approximately 5,443 km or 3,382 mi.
- To reach Cork in this distance one would set out from Bushehr bearing 315.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cork bearing 274° or W .
- Cork has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Bushehr has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The average temperature is 14.1 °C (25.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.2 °C (14.8°F) less in Cork.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 819.5 mm (32.3 in) more which is equivalent to 819.5 l/m² (20.11 US gal/ft²) or 8,195,000 l/ha (876,100 US gal/ac) more. About 4 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.9° lower in Cork than in Bushehr.
- Relative humidity levels are 19.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 9.5°C (17°F) lower.
